The Role
We are looking for a proactive and welcoming Receptionist to join our Ipswich clinic on a full-time basis, with the view of this individual being a long-term team member. Applicants seeking to join our team as a Receptionist on a part-time basis will also be considered!
You’ll be the first point of contact for our patients, making an impactful first impression while managing day-to-day operations to ensure a smooth experience for both patients and staff. This is an excellent opportunity to be part of our growing team in a vibrant, cutting-edge facility.
Your key responsibilities:
Greet patients warmly and handle inquiries in a friendly, professional manner
Manage appointment bookings, cancellations, and patient records with attention to detail
Provide support for administrative tasks, such as handling payments, handling phone and email enquiries, and managing patient records.
Collaborate closely with the clinical team to ensure efficient scheduling and patient flow
Maintain a clean and organised reception area, reflecting the high standards of our clinic
